The Ministry of the Environment and Energy Security (MASE) has issued, across two rounds of authorizations in March 2026, a total of seven directorial decrees for new battery energy storage system (BESS) facilities amounting to 467 MW of combined capacity.

As of most recent estimates, the cost of a BESS by MW is between $200,000 and $420,000, varying by location, system size, and market conditions. This translates to around $150 - $420 per kWh, though in some markets, prices have dropped as low as $120 - $140 per kWh.
